At time of appointment to the Court Officers Academy, candidate must be at least 20½ years of age, NYS resident, a US citizen and have a valid NYS Driver License. New York State Court Officer-Trainees enter the academy at Judicial Grade 16**. Effective April 2020, starting salary will be $51,113. • Location Pay is $4300 for New York City, Nassau, Suffolk, Rockland, and Westchester Counties.Court Clerks. Court clerks may be assigned to work in courtrooms or back-office support units where they perform a variety of tasks, including calling the calendar, preparing written correspondence and examining court documents to ensure accuracy. Court Officer Exam: This exam is for individuals seeking employment as a Court Officer, responsible for providing security in New York State courts.Budget your time wisely. Take note of the test time allowance and of the starting and stopping times. Look at the whole test first, then decide how much time to allow yourself for each part. You get just as much credit for an easy question as for a hard one. New York State Court Officers are peace officers responsible for providing law enforcement, security services and maintaining order in the courtrooms and building facilities.
